site stats

Byref byval デフォルト

WebJul 14, 2024 · ByRefとは VBAでは、参照渡しはByRefとなり、ByValは値渡しとして使用します。 ByRefの参考として、下記のコードを実行すると、msgboxに表示される値は「2」となります。 また、ByValの参考として、下記のコードを実行すると、msgboxに表示される値は「1」となります。 前の記事 serializeの読み方 2024.07.14 次の記事 ADSL … Web実は、引数を参照渡しで受け取るときは、引数の定義に ByRef というキーワードを付けるのが基本ルールです。 Sub Sample () Dim buf As String buf = "tanaka" ''変数に文字 …

人体内维生素B12贮存量为()A、1~2mgB、2~3mgC …

WebAug 22, 2024 · ByRefとByValの違い それぞれのメソッドの中で、受け取った変数をそのまま2倍していますが 以下のような違いがあります。 ByVal :引数「hoge」の値は変わ … WebFeb 2, 2024 · 今回は、ByValとByRefの違いについてまとめていきます。 それでは、さっそく見ていきましょう ByValとByRefの違い 関数には引数 (パラメータ)を設定することができます。 始めてプログラミングをやっていた時、本とかでByVal(値渡し)はByRef(参照渡し)... healthy living almond milk https://hireproconstruction.com

vb.net - Should a ByRef be used in a function? - Stack Overflow

Web実は、引数を参照渡しで受け取るときは、引数の定義に ByRef というキーワードを付けるのが基本ルールです。 Sub Sample () Dim buf As String buf = "tanaka" ''変数に文字列"tanaka"を入れる Call Proc1 ( buf) ''プロシージャProc1の引数に変数を渡して呼び出す MsgBox buf ''変数の値を表示する End Sub ''引数を参照渡しで受け取る Sub Proc1 ( … WebByValとByRefのデフォルト プロシージャ(関数)へ引数を渡す方法には、主に「値渡し」と「参照渡し」の2つの方法がある。 VB 6(Visual Basic 6.0)では、それぞれ … WebMar 21, 2024 · そのため、引数元の値を変えたくない場合は、値渡し (ByVal)を使います。 何も指定しなかった場合は、デフォルトで参照渡し (ByRef)になっているので、変数 … motown cartoon netflix

VBA 引数ByRefまたはByValを渡す - learntutorials.net

Category:【vb.net】 引数を省略可能にするOptinal 新米Plog

Tags:Byref byval デフォルト

Byref byval デフォルト

引数の参照渡し・値渡し( ByRef, ByVal ) ExcelWork.info

Webレベル1 ByVal? ByRef? 何それ? レベル2 引渡しなんぞ使わん!スコープ変えて宣言だ! レベル3 え~~~~?デフォルトってByRef だったの?マジで? 名前からして解りにくい。値渡し、参照渡し、どっちがどっち … Web因为参数C是按地址传送(默认为按地址传送,即ByRef),故z的值变为12了,所以输出值为12。 第2题: 阅读如下程序, a = 1: b = 2: plus S, a, b: Print S:不能使其输出结果为3的plus过程为( )。

Byref byval デフォルト

Did you know?

WebNov 14, 2008 · Sometimes you must make consessions, i.e. using byRef. For example if you can get a fix in done in 2 days using byRef then that can be preferable to re-inventing the wheel and taking a week to get the same fix in just to avoid using byRef. Summary: Using byVal on a value type: Passes a value to a function. This is the preferred way to … WebFeb 2, 2024 · そう、ByValの時は、関数内でいくら値を代入しても、反映されないのです! 続いて、ByRefを見ていきましょう。 ByRefの場合 Private Sub BtnByRef_Click …

WebFeb 27, 2024 · 参照渡し(ByRef)の場合は関数内部で変数に加えた変更が呼び出し元でも引き継がれますが、値渡し(ByVal)の場合は引き継がれず、関数を呼び出したとき … Webしかし、ByVal、ByRefのどちらのキーワードも書かなかった場合のデフォルトについて、VB 6とVB.NETの間には相違が存在する。まず、無指定、ByVal、ByRefの3つの引数を使ったVB 6のサンプル・プログラムを見てみよう(リスト1-21)。

WebAug 30, 2024 · vb.netで、任意の引数として扱う方法を紹介します。 デフォルト値が設定できるので、非常に便利です! 目次 デフォルト値のある引数 サンプルコード 解説 複数の引数がある場合 途中の引数を省略したい場合 最後に デフォルト値のある引数 引数の宣言に Optinal を付け、デフォルト値を設定します。 メソッドを呼び出す際に任意の引数とし … WebApr 6, 2024 · それは既定であるため、メソッド シグネチャに ByVal キーワードを明示的に指定する必要はありません。 それにより、ノイズが多いコードが生成される傾向があるため、既定でない ByRef キーワードが見落とされることが多くなります。

WebJan 24, 2024 · ByVal (値渡し)とByRef (参照渡し)に使い分けがあるというよりは、 関数化の目的があり、それによってどっちを使うべきか決まるという話ですね。 ByVal (値渡し)とByRef (参照渡し)の使い分けを理解するということは、 プロシージャ分割の原理をきっちり学ぶことに等しいと思います。 いきなり完璧に理解する必要はないと思いますので …

WebPrivate Sub onBinaryLoad(ByVal sender As Object, ByVal e As OpenReadCompletedEventArgs) If Not (e.[Error] IsNot Nothing) OrElse (e.Cancelled) Then ... ByRef Cancel As Boolean) Handles appevent.SheetBeforeDoubleClick ... 指定のフォントはデフォルト値である「MS ゴシック」「14.25」です。 ... motown casinohttp://www.uwenku.com/question/p-tygwcjso-ws.html motown cartoon netflix castWebByRefおよびByVal修飾子は、プロシージャのシグネチャの一部であり、引数がプロシージャに渡される方法を示します。VBAでは、特に指定されていない限り、 ByRefが渡されます( ByRefは、存在しない場合は暗黙的です)。 注意:他の多くのプログラミング言語(VB.NETを含む)では、修飾子が指定さ ... motown casino buffetWebJun 22, 2024 · ByVal(値渡し)とByRef(参照渡し) ByVal:値渡し 変数の中のデータを渡すもので、呼出側の変数は影響を受けません。 つまり、値渡しでは、呼出し先で引 … motown cartoonWebNov 14, 2008 · Sometimes you must make consessions, i.e. using byRef. For example if you can get a fix in done in 2 days using byRef then that can be preferable to re … healthy living at home carson city nvWebWe don’t need to write ByRef before argument. Syntax: Sub x (a as Variant) ‘Or. Sub x (ByRef a as Variant) ByVal argument: It is a literal short form of by value. When an argument is passed as ByVal argument to a different sub or function, only the value of the argument is sent. The original argument is left intact. healthy living at home hhWebJavaScript扩展语法与jQuery$.extend-ByRef和ByVal,javascript,extend,spread-syntax,Javascript,Extend,Spread Syntax,我试图更新一个嵌套很深的对象,因此它有一个很长的名称,我不想一直在代码中键入。 motown casino events